The reason for using the silver oxide batteries is that their voltage
drop curve is closer to that of the mercury battery being replaced by
the adapter and battery.

> 5. Insert the adapter into the battery compartment, then lay the
> shimmed batteries over it.  If it doesn't work, try reversing the
> adapter.  It will only conduct current one way (that is the function
> of a diode, the voltage drop is incidental.)
> 

The voltage drop may be incidental to the purpose of the diode in
normal applications, but it is the whole point in the mercury battery
replacement adapter.
